Northern Ireland Life and Times Survey, 2006

Variable Details

Variablehsarea17
LabelQSC.1 Time spent waiting an ambulance after a 999 call
Question text From what you know or have heard, please tick a box for each of the items below to show whether you think the National Health Service in your area is, on the whole, satisfactory or in need of improvement. Time spent waiting for an ambulance after a 999 call.
Responses
1 In need of a lot of improvement 125
2 In need of some improvement 275
3 Satisfactory 346
4 Very good 142
8 Can't choose 298
9 Not answered 17
-1 No self completion 27
DisclaimerPlease note that these frequencies are not weighted.
LocationNorthern Ireland Life and Times Survey, 2006
Interviewer Instructions(Please tick one box on each line)
UniverseNorthern Irish adults;National;Adults aged 18 or over, living in private households in Northern Ireland during 2006.
SamplingOne-stage stratified or systematic random sample
Study TypeRepeated cross-sectional study
